Projeto de Extensão II Analise e Desenvolvimento de Sistemas
O Projeto de Extensão II Análise e Desenvolvimento de Sistemas visa aplicar conhecimentos teóricos e práticos adquiridos ao longo do curso para solucionar problemas reais por meio da tecnologia. Essa iniciativa busca integrar os estudantes ao mercado de trabalho e à comunidade, promovendo a criação de soluções inovadoras e funcionais para diferentes setores. A disciplina enfatiza a importância da análise de requisitos, modelagem de sistemas, desenvolvimento e implementação de software, bem como testes e validação.
No decorrer do projeto, os alunos trabalham em equipe para desenvolver aplicações que atendam às necessidades de clientes reais ou fictícios, utilizando metodologias ágeis, como Scrum ou Kanban, para garantir a eficiência no desenvolvimento. Além disso, são incentivados a adotar boas práticas de programação, segurança da informação e usabilidade, tornando as soluções mais robustas e acessíveis. O uso de tecnologias modernas, como inteligência artificial, big data e computação em nuvem, também pode ser explorado conforme a complexidade do projeto.
A realização desse projeto permite que os alunos aprimorem suas habilidades técnicas e interpessoais, como comunicação, trabalho em equipe e resolução de problemas. Além disso, fortalece a relação entre a academia e a sociedade, proporcionando impactos positivos por meio da tecnologia. Dessa forma, o Projeto de Extensão II desempenha um papel fundamental na formação dos estudantes de Análise e Desenvolvimento de Sistemas, preparando-os para os desafios do mercado de trabalho e incentivando a inovação e o empreendedorismo.
Além do desenvolvimento técnico, o Projeto de Extensão II também estimula a reflexão sobre a ética no desenvolvimento de software, abordando temas como privacidade de dados, acessibilidade digital e impacto social das tecnologias. Os alunos são incentivados a considerar não apenas a viabilidade técnica das soluções, mas também sua relevância e sustentabilidade no contexto em que serão aplicadas. Dessa forma, o projeto não apenas capacita os estudantes para atuar no mercado, mas também os sensibiliza quanto à responsabilidade social e ambiental da tecnologia.
Outro aspecto fundamental do projeto é a interdisciplinaridade, permitindo que os alunos colaborem com profissionais de outras áreas, como gestão, saúde, educação e engenharia, dependendo do escopo da solução desenvolvida. Essa interação enriquece o aprendizado e amplia a visão dos estudantes sobre as possibilidades de aplicação da tecnologia em diferentes contextos. Além disso, a participação em projetos reais pode resultar em oportunidades de estágio e networking com empresas e instituições parceiras.
Por fim, o Projeto de Extensão II representa um momento crucial na formação dos estudantes de Análise e Desenvolvimento de Sistemas, pois permite consolidar conhecimentos e aprimorar habilidades que serão essenciais para a carreira profissional. Ao final do projeto, os alunos apresentam suas soluções em eventos acadêmicos, feiras tecnológicas ou diretamente para clientes, recebendo feedbacks valiosos para seu crescimento. Assim, essa iniciativa não apenas contribui para a formação de profissionais mais capacitados, mas também reforça o papel da universidade como agente de transformação e inovação na sociedade.
Projeto de Extensão II: Análise e Desenvolvimento de Sistemas
O Projeto de Extensão II no curso de Análise e Desenvolvimento de Sistemas (ADS) desempenha um papel essencial na formação dos estudantes, proporcionando uma oportunidade de aplicação prática dos conhecimentos adquiridos ao longo da graduação. Esse tipo de iniciativa busca integrar teoria e prática, permitindo que os alunos desenvolvam soluções tecnológicas para problemas reais da sociedade, empresas ou instituições públicas. O projeto enfatiza o uso de metodologias ágeis, técnicas de engenharia de software e desenvolvimento de sistemas informatizados eficientes, promovendo a inovação e a capacitação profissional dos participantes.
Segundo Pressman (2022), a engenharia de software é um campo que exige não apenas conhecimento técnico, mas também uma abordagem sistemática para o desenvolvimento de aplicações. O Projeto de Extensão II segue essa abordagem ao incentivar os alunos a realizarem levantamento de requisitos, modelagem de dados e processos, implementação de soluções computacionais e testes de software. Dessa forma, os estudantes aprendem a lidar com todas as etapas do ciclo de vida do desenvolvimento de software, desde a concepção da ideia até a sua entrega final.
Metodologias Utilizadas e Aplicação Prática
Na prática, os alunos desenvolvem projetos de software utilizando metodologias ágeis, como o Scrum (Schwaber & Sutherland, 2020), para garantir um processo de desenvolvimento dinâmico e iterativo. Isso permite que as equipes realizem entregas incrementais, aprimorando suas soluções ao longo do tempo com base no feedback dos usuários finais. Além disso, a utilização de frameworks modernos, como Django, Laravel, React e Node.js, possibilita a criação de aplicações escaláveis e de fácil manutenção.
Um exemplo prático desse projeto pode ser a criação de um sistema de gestão para pequenas empresas. Esse sistema pode incluir módulos para controle de estoque, vendas, emissão de notas fiscais e gerenciamento de clientes. A implementação pode envolver tecnologias como bancos de dados relacionais (MySQL, PostgreSQL) e não relacionais (MongoDB), além de APIs REST para integração com outros serviços.
Outro caso prático é o desenvolvimento de um aplicativo móvel para acompanhamento de saúde, voltado para pacientes e profissionais da área médica. Nesse contexto, os alunos podem aplicar conceitos de segurança da informação e proteção de dados, garantindo que a aplicação esteja em conformidade com a Lei Geral de Proteção de Dados (LGPD) no Brasil.
Impacto Social e Profissional
O Projeto de Extensão II não apenas capacita os alunos tecnicamente, mas também promove o impacto social ao desenvolver soluções para problemas reais enfrentados por comunidades e organizações. Segundo Sommerville (2020), a responsabilidade social do software deve ser um aspecto essencial do desenvolvimento de sistemas, garantindo que as soluções sejam inclusivas e acessíveis.
Além disso, a experiência adquirida nesse projeto é um diferencial para o mercado de trabalho. Os alunos aprendem a trabalhar em equipe, lidar com prazos, apresentar suas soluções e receber críticas construtivas, habilidades essenciais para qualquer desenvolvedor. Muitas vezes, os projetos desenvolvidos durante a disciplina se transformam em startups ou produtos viáveis para o mercado, abrindo portas para empreendimentos inovadores.
O resultado final foi excelente
Recomendo.
a equipe responsável pelo projeto foi muito atenciosa e prestativa.
a equipe responsável pelo projeto foi muito atenciosa e prestativa.